#6e6c4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e6c4c is composed of 43.1% red, 42.4%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.8% magenta, 30.9%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 56.5 degrees, a saturation of 18.3% and a lightness of 36.5%. #6e6c4c color hex could be obtained by blending #dcd898 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#6e6c4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e6c4c has RGB values of R:110, G:108,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.31,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7236684.

Shades and Tints of #6e6c4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060504 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e6c4c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605f5a is the less saturated color, while #b6ab04 is the most saturated one.
